Timezone in Nanhera
Nanhera is situated in the Asia/Kolkata timezone, which has a UTC offset of +5:30. This means that Nanhera is five hours and thirty minutes ahead of Coordinated Universal Time. India does not observe daylight saving time, so the standard time remains consistent throughout the year without any changes.
When comparing the time difference between Nanhera and various locations in the United States, the gap can be quite significant. For example, when it is noon in Nanhera, it is 1:30 AM in New York (Eastern Time) and 10:30 PM the previous day in Los Angeles (Pacific Time). This difference can affect communication and scheduling, making it essential to plan calls or meetings during overlapping waking hours.
The best time to contact someone in Nanhera is typically between 8 AM and 10 PM local time, which corresponds to 9:30 PM to 11:30 AM in New York and 6:30 PM to 8:30 AM in Los Angeles. In comparison with other major cities in the region, such as Delhi and Mumbai, Nanhera shares the same timezone and UTC offset. Practical Information for Visitors
Nanhera is a small village in the northern part of India, primarily accessible by road. The nearest major airport is in Chandigarh, approximately 90 kilometers away, while the closest railway station is at Ambala, around 30 kilometers from Nanhera. Buses and taxis are available from these locations, providing convenient transport options to reach the village.
The weather in Nanhera is typical of the northern Indian plains, with hot summers and cool winters. From April to June, temperatures can soar above 40 degrees Celsius, making it uncomfortable for outdoor activities. The monsoon season lasts from July to September, bringing moderate rainfall, while the winter months from November to February are much cooler, with temperatures dropping to around 5 degrees Celsius at night.
The best time to visit Nanhera is during the winter months, particularly from November to February, when the weather is pleasant for exploration. Visitors should dress in layers due to the temperature fluctuations between day and night. It’s also advisable to carry water and snacks while exploring, as local amenities may be limited.
